AI Capital Barbell
Projection: Funding data already sketches a split market: immense checks cluster around frontier platforms while application activity spreads across narrower workflows. That pattern could harden into a durable two-pole economy. It fails if specialist companies cannot preserve financing and renewals while foundation-model vendors continue attracting capital.
